
The Uritsky District Court of the Oryol Region refused the parole of Oleg Navalny, convicted with his brother in the Yves Rocher case, Mediazone reports .
As previously reported , Navalny received several new penalties on the eve of UPO meeting. The opposition suggested that he could tighten the conditions of detention due to penalties.

It was originally planned that the meeting would be held in the colony due to the fact that repairs were in court, but they refused these actions. During the hearing, the judge introduced the defense materials to the case, although the prosecutor's office objected. The convict said that he satisfied the claim of the victim, and also described the process of recovery from the colony administration.
“I wake up in the room, I go along it and fall asleep there. Periodically come and say: “The penalties were imposed on you.” If I were in a bad relationship with the administration, I would probably set fire to something in the cell and rushed at people, ”he said.
Oleg and Alexei Navalny together were accused of Yves Rocher, the younger brother received 3.5 years in a colony, the eldest - the same conditional term. The brothers themselves insisted on their innocence and declared the case politically motivated. The verdict was issued in December 2014.
